A leading construction and design firm in Greater London is seeking an experienced Document Controller. Procore experience is essential for this role. The successful candidate will manage project documentation, ensuring accuracy and compliance, while supporting project teams. This is a fantastic opportunity for a highly organized professional who thrives on accuracy and structure. Long-term career progression and a competitive salary are offered for this full-time role.
